Permainan Coding Untuk Anak
Pentingnya Permainan Coding untuk Anak
Permainan coding untuk anak adalah salah satu metode pembelajaran yang memiliki manfaat yang luar biasa. Dengan memperkenalkan anak-anak pada dunia pemrograman sejak dini, akan memberikan mereka keunggulan dalam kemampuan pemecahan masalah, kreativitas, dan pemikiran logis. Permainan coding juga dapat membantu anak mengembangkan keterampilan teknologi informasi yang sangat penting di era digital ini.
Manfaat pertama dari permainan coding untuk anak adalah meningkatkan kemampuan pemecahan masalah. Saat belajar coding, anak-anak diajarkan untuk memecahkan masalah dan mengembangkan algoritma. Mereka belajar bagaimana menyusun langkah-langkah logis untuk mencapai tujuan tertentu. Kemampuan ini juga dapat membantu mereka dalam kehidupan sehari-hari, di mana mereka dapat menerapkan pemikiran sistematis dalam menyelesaikan masalah.
Selain itu, permainan coding juga mampu meningkatkan kreativitas anak. Saat belajar coding, anak-anak diberi kebebasan untuk menciptakan sesuatu yang unik sesuai dengan imajinasi mereka. Mereka dapat merancang permainan, aplikasi, atau website sesuai dengan keinginan mereka. Hal ini tidak hanya meningkatkan kreativitas, tetapi juga memberikan rasa percaya diri ketika melihat hasil karya yang mereka buat.
Permainan coding juga membantu anak mengembangkan pemikiran logis. Mereka belajar tentang urutan logis, pengulangan, dan pemilihan, yang semuanya merupakan konsep penting dalam pemrograman. Dengan memahami konsep-konsep ini, anak-anak dapat melatih otak mereka untuk berpikir secara sistematis dan analitis.
Salah satu manfaat penting lainnya dari permainan coding untuk anak adalah meningkatkan keterampilan teknologi informasi. Di masa depan, kemampuan dalam bidang teknologi informasi akan menjadi sangat berharga. Dengan menguasai coding sejak dini, anak-anak akan memiliki keunggulan kompetitif di dunia kerja nantinya. Mereka akan lebih siap menghadapi tantangan teknologi yang terus berkembang.
Dalam mengenalkan permainan coding kepada anak, penting untuk memilih platform pembelajaran yang sesuai dengan usia dan minat mereka. Ada berbagai aplikasi dan permainan coding yang dirancang khusus untuk anak-anak, yang menawarkan pengalaman belajar yang menyenangkan dan interaktif. Dengan pendekatan yang tepat, anak-anak dapat belajar coding tanpa tekanan dan dengan penuh antusiasme.
Dengan demikian, penting untuk memperhatikan pentingnya permainan coding untuk anak. Selain memberikan manfaat dalam pengembangan keterampilan teknis, permainan coding juga dapat membantu anak mengembangkan kemampuan sosial, seperti kerjasama dan komunikasi. Dengan memberikan kesempatan kepada anak-anak untuk belajar coding sejak dini, kita dapat membantu mereka menjadi generasi yang siap menghadapi tantangan masa depan yang penuh teknologi.
Manfaat Pengembangan Keterampilan Kognitif melalui Permainan Koding
Pengembangan keterampilan kognitif melalui permainan koding merupakan sebuah metode yang efektif untuk meningkatkan kemampuan anak dalam pemecahan masalah, kreativitas, dan pemikiran logis. Terlibat dalam permainan koding dapat memberikan manfaat yang luas bagi perkembangan kognitif anak-anak, mempersiapkan mereka untuk menghadapi tantangan teknologi di era digital saat ini.
Manfaat Permainan Koding untuk Anak
Permainan koding memungkinkan anak-anak untuk belajar secara aktif melalui eksperimen dan penyelesaian masalah. Berikut adalah beberapa manfaat utama dari pengembangan keterampilan kognitif melalui permainan koding:
1. Peningkatan Kemampuan Pemecahan Masalah
Dengan bermain koding, anak-anak diajak untuk memecahkan masalah secara sistematis dan logis. Mereka belajar untuk menguraikan masalah menjadi langkah-langkah yang lebih kecil dan menyelesaikannya secara terstruktur.
2. Stimulasi Kreativitas
Permainan koding mendorong anak-anak untuk berpikir kreatif dalam merancang solusi untuk setiap tugas yang diberikan. Mereka dapat bereksperimen dengan berbagai ide dan melihat hasil dari kreasi mereka.
3. Pengembangan Kemampuan Berpikir Logis
Melalui permainan koding, anak-anak dilatih untuk berpikir logis dan sistematis. Mereka belajar tentang urutan perintah dan konsep logika yang mendasari pemrograman komputer.
4. Meningkatkan Konsentrasi dan Ketelitian
Kegiatan koding membutuhkan tingkat konsentrasi yang tinggi agar tidak terjadi kesalahan dalam menyelesaikan tugas. Anak-anak belajar untuk fokus dan teliti dalam setiap langkah yang mereka ambil.
5. Memperkenalkan Konsep Teknologi
Dengan terlibat dalam permainan koding, anak-anak diperkenalkan pada konsep-konsep dasar teknologi informasi. Mereka memahami cara kerja program komputer dan logika di balik teknologi yang mereka gunakan sehari-hari.
Implementasi Permainan Koding dalam Pendidikan Anak
Pendidikan anak melalui permainan koding dapat dilakukan baik di lingkungan sekolah maupun di rumah. Berikut adalah beberapa cara implementasi permainan koding dalam pendidikan anak:
- Menggunakan aplikasi khusus permainan koding yang disesuaikan dengan usia anak.
- Melibatkan anak dalam proyek-proyek kecil yang mendorong mereka untuk berkolaborasi dan berkreasi.
- Mengadakan sesi belajar koding secara berkala untuk membimbing anak dalam memahami konsep-konsep dasar pemrograman.
Permainan koding tidak hanya memberikan manfaat dalam pengembangan keterampilan kognitif anak, tetapi juga membantu mereka mempersiapkan diri untuk menghadapi dunia digital yang semakin kompleks. Dengan adanya pendekatan bermain yang menyenangkan, anak-anak dapat belajar dengan lebih mudah dan efektif sambil mengasah kemampuan kognitif mereka.
Pilihan Permainan Koding yang Cocok untuk Anak
Permainan coding untuk anak adalah cara yang menyenangkan dan interaktif untuk memperkenalkan konsep pemrograman kepada anak-anak. Dengan memainkan permainan koding, anak-anak dapat belajar logika, pemecahan masalah, dan keterampilan teknologi yang penting sejak dini. Berikut adalah beberapa pilihan permainan koding yang cocok untuk anak:
1. Code.org
Code.org merupakan platform pembelajaran koding yang ramah anak dan sangat interaktif. Anak-anak dapat belajar pemrograman melalui permainan dengan karakter-karakter yang lucu dan menarik. Code.org menawarkan berbagai kursus koding mulai dari yang paling dasar hingga tingkat lanjut, sehingga cocok untuk anak usia dini hingga remaja.
2. Scratch
Scratch adalah platform koding yang dikembangkan oleh MIT Media Lab. Scratch menggunakan sistem kode blok yang memungkinkan anak-anak untuk membuat program dengan cara menyusun blok-blok kode secara visual. Anak-anak dapat membuat proyek-proyek kreatif seperti permainan, animasi, dan kisah interaktif secara intuitif melalui Scratch.
3. Tynker
Tynker adalah platform koding yang dirancang khusus untuk anak-anak. Dengan Tynker, anak-anak dapat belajar koding melalui modul-modul pembelajaran yang menyenangkan dan menantang. Tynker juga menawarkan berbagai kursus koding yang dirancang untuk memperkenalkan konsep pemrograman secara bertahap kepada anak-anak.
4. Algoid
Algoid adalah aplikasi koding berbasis Android yang cocok untuk anak-anak yang lebih suka belajar melalui perangkat seluler. Dengan antarmuka yang sederhana dan intuitif, anak-anak dapat belajar membuat program sederhana menggunakan blok kode dengan mudah. Algoid dapat menjadi pilihan yang tepat untuk anak-anak yang ingin belajar koding secara mandiri.
5. Hakitzu Elite
Hakitzu Elite adalah permainan koding yang menggabungkan pemrograman dengan pertarungan robot. Anak-anak dapat memprogram robot pertarungan mereka sendiri menggunakan bahasa kode JavaScript sambil bersenang-senang dalam pertarungan virtual. Hakitzu Elite dapat membantu anak-anak memahami konsep koding melalui permainan yang menarik dan kompetitif.
Dengan memilih permainan koding yang sesuai dengan minat dan tingkat pemahaman anak, orangtua dapat membantu mereka belajar keterampilan penting seperti pemecahan masalah, kreativitas, dan logika. Permainan koding tidak hanya mengajarkan anak-anak tentang pemrograman, tetapi juga membantu mereka mengembangkan kemampuan berpikir kritis dan analitis sejak dini. Dengan adanya pilihan permainan koding yang menarik dan interaktif, anak-anak dapat belajar keterampilan teknologi dengan cara yang menyenangkan dan mendidik.
Bagaimana Orang Tua Dapat Mendorong Anak Bermain dengan Koding secara Positif
Coding untuk anak adalah kegiatan yang sangat bermanfaat untuk perkembangan mereka. Dengan cara ini, anak-anak dapat belajar berpikir logis, meningkatkan kreativitas, dan mengasah kemampuan problem-solving. Bagi orang tua, mendorong anak untuk bermain dengan coding secara positif dapat membawa banyak manfaat jangka panjang. Berikut adalah beberapa cara yang dapat dilakukan oleh orang tua untuk mendorong anak bermain dengan coding secara positif:
Menyediakan Akses ke Permainan Coding
Langkah pertama yang harus diambil oleh orang tua adalah menyediakan akses yang cukup bagi anak untuk mulai belajar tentang coding. Hal ini dapat dilakukan dengan mengunduh aplikasi atau perangkat lunak yang cocok untuk usia anak. Pastikan permainan-permainan tersebut menawarkan tantangan yang sesuai dengan tingkat pemahaman anak.
Libatkan Anak dalam Proses Pembelajaran
Orang tua dapat membantu anak belajar coding dengan terlibat langsung dalam proses pembelajarannya. Ajak anak untuk bermain bersama dan berikan bantuan jika diperlukan. Dengan cara ini, anak akan merasa didukung dan termotivasi untuk terus belajar.
Perkuat Kreativitas Anak
Coding dapat membantu meningkatkan kreativitas anak. Ajak mereka untuk berpikir out of the box saat menyelesaikan masalah dan mencari solusi. Dorong anak untuk menciptakan proyek-proyek coding mereka sendiri dan berikan apresiasi atas usaha dan kreasi yang mereka hasilkan.
Jadwalkan Sesuatu yang Menyenangkan
Agar anak tetap termotivasi dalam belajar coding, penting untuk menjadwalkan sesuatu yang menyenangkan seputar coding. Misalnya, buatlah sesi belajar coding menjadi suatu permainan dengan hadiah-hadiah kecil yang dapat memotivasi anak.
Dukung Keinginan Anak
Setiap anak memiliki minat dan keinginan yang berbeda. Karena itu, orang tua perlu mendukung keinginan anak terkait coding. Jika anak tertarik pada suatu topik tertentu dalam dunia coding, bantu mereka untuk mengeksplorasi lebih lanjut dan pelajari hal tersebut.
Berikan Pujian dan Dorongan
Pujian dan dorongan dari orang tua sangat penting dalam proses belajar anak. Dengan memberikan pujian yang tulus dan dorongan positif, anak akan merasa bangga dengan pencapaian mereka dalam belajar coding.
Contohkan Penggunaan Coding dalam Kehidupan Sehari-hari
Orang tua dapat memberikan contoh nyata bagaimana coding digunakan dalam kehidupan sehari-hari. Misalnya, jelaskan bagaimana aplikasi yang sering digunakan seperti media sosial atau game dibuat melalui coding. Hal ini dapat membantu anak memahami relevansi dan pentingnya belajar coding.
Kenalkan Anak pada Komunitas Coding
Mendorong anak untuk bergabung dalam komunitas atau kelompok belajar coding dapat memberikan pengalaman yang berharga. Mereka dapat berbagi pengetahuan, belajar dari orang lain, dan merasa termotivasi dalam mengembangkan keterampilan coding mereka.
Dengan mendorong anak untuk bermain dengan coding secara positif, orang tua dapat membantu menciptakan generasi yang terampil dalam teknologi dan siap menghadapi tuntutan masa depan. Mendukung anak dalam belajar coding akan membuka peluang-peluang baru bagi mereka dan membantu mempersiapkan mereka untuk dunia yang semakin digital.
Mengatasi Tantangan dalam Memperkenalkan Permainan Koding kepada Anak
Menghadapi Tantangan dalam Memperkenalkan Permainan Koding kepada Anak
Di era digital seperti sekarang ini, memperkenalkan keterampilan pemrograman atau coding kepada anak merupakan langkah penting dalam mempersiapkan generasi masa depan. Namun, seringkali orangtua atau pendidik menghadapi beberapa tantangan ketika mencoba memperkenalkan permainan koding kepada anak-anak. Berikut adalah beberapa strategi untuk mengatasi tantangan tersebut:
1. Pilih Platform Pembelajaran yang Sesuai
Memilih platform pembelajaran yang sesuai dengan usia dan minat anak sangat penting. Pastikan platform tersebut menyediakan permainan koding yang interaktif dan menarik. Contohnya, Scratch atau Code.org yang dirancang khusus untuk anak-anak dengan antarmuka yang ramah anak.
2. Libatkan Anak dalam Proses Belajar
Untuk membuat pengalaman belajar menjadi lebih menyenangkan, libatkan anak dalam pemilihan permainan koding yang ingin mereka pelajari. Biarkan mereka memilih proyek atau permainan yang menarik bagi mereka agar motivasi belajar tetap tinggi.
3. Berikan Pujian dan Dukungan
Ketika anak berhasil menyelesaikan sebuah proyek koding atau mengatasi tantangan dalam permainan, jangan lupa memberikan pujian dan dukungan. Hal ini akan membangun rasa percaya diri anak serta membuat mereka semakin termotivasi untuk terus belajar.
4. Tetapkan Tujuan yang Realistis
Saat memperkenalkan permainan koding kepada anak, tentukan tujuan yang realistis sesuai dengan tingkat pemahaman dan usia mereka. Jangan terlalu memaksakan untuk menyelesaikan proyek yang terlalu kompleks, namun tingkatkan tingkat kesulitan secara bertahap.
5. Berikan Dukungan Teknis
Terkadang, anak-anak akan mengalami kesulitan dalam memahami konsep-konsep koding. Pastikan Anda selalu memberikan dukungan teknis dan menjelaskan secara perlahan agar mereka dapat memahami dengan baik.
6. Ajak Anak Berkolaborasi
Mendorong anak untuk berkolaborasi dengan teman-temannya dalam mempelajari permainan koding juga merupakan langkah yang baik. Mereka dapat saling belajar dan bertukar ide, sehingga proses belajar akan menjadi lebih menyenangkan dan interaktif.
7. Tetapkan Waktu Belajar yang Konsisten
Konsistensi dalam belajar sangat penting. Tetapkan jadwal belajar koding yang rutin dan pastikan anak memiliki waktu yang cukup untuk bereksplorasi dan mencoba berbagai permainan koding.
Dengan mengikuti strategi di atas, Anda dapat mengatasi tantangan dalam memperkenalkan permainan koding kepada anak-anak. Ingatlah bahwa setiap anak memiliki kemampuan dan minat yang berbeda, sehingga penting untuk selalu memahami kebutuhan dan preferensi mereka dalam proses belajar. Semoga artikel ini bermanfaat dalam membantu Anda mendukung anak-anak dalam mengembangkan keterampilan koding mereka.
Conclusion
Dari pembahasan di atas, terlihat jelas betapa pentingnya permainan coding untuk anak dalam perkembangan mereka. Selain dapat mengembangkan keterampilan kognitif seperti pemecahan masalah, kreativitas, dan logika, permainan koding juga memberikan manfaat jangka panjang dalam membentuk pola pikir anak-anak. Adanya pilihan permainan koding yang disesuaikan dengan usia dan minat anak memungkinkan mereka untuk belajar dengan cara yang menyenangkan dan interaktif.
Sebagai orang tua, mendukung anak dalam bermain dengan koding merupakan langkah positif yang dapat dilakukan. Melalui dukungan, dorongan, dan pengawasan yang tepat, orang tua dapat membantu anak mengatasi berbagai tantangan yang mungkin timbul dalam mempelajari keterampilan ini. Dengan pendekatan yang sabar dan penuh pengertian, orang tua dapat memastikan bahwa anak merasa nyaman dan termotivasi untuk terus belajar.
Meskipun terdapat beberapa tantangan dalam memperkenalkan permainan koding kepada anak, seperti keterbatasan waktu dan sumber daya, hal ini dapat diatasi dengan strategi yang tepat. Konsistensi dalam memberikan kesempatan kepada anak untuk bermain dengan koding, serta penggunaan pendekatan yang sesuai dengan karakteristik mereka, akan membantu meminimalisir hambatan yang mungkin muncul.
Dengan demikian, permainan coding untuk anak bukan hanya sekadar aktivitas menyenangkan, tetapi juga merupakan investasi bernilai dalam perkembangan mereka. Melalui berbagai manfaat yang ditawarkannya, permainan koding dapat membantu anak mengasah kemampuan kognitifnya sejak dini, sehingga mereka siap menghadapi tantangan di era digital yang semakin kompleks. Dukungan dan bimbingan dari orang tua akan menjadi kunci keberhasilan dalam mengenalkan dunia koding kepada anak-anak, sehingga mereka dapat tumbuh dan berkembang menjadi generasi yang kreatif, inovatif, dan siap bersaing di masa depan.